How reliable is the Evo V?

I've been looking into them and they fit my price range well, have four doors, and seem overall pretty practical combined with fun and an aesthetic appearance, so the only question left on my mind is how reliable they would be if I intend to use one as a DD?
20 posts and 2 images submitted.
>>
>>16738201
Gas is terrible
What are the chances of buying an unabused one?

Prepare to spend money on clutches if it was previously abused (if fitted with an aftermarket clutch, prepare to rebuild your trans), also if with stock turbo and it was fitted with a boost controller prepare for rebuild or replacement of your turbo.

Also no gas.
>>
It's an older vehicle so it's going to have occasionally maintenance to begin with.

However one thing to consider is that not only is this an AWD vehicle (meaning more expensive to maintain) but it's a vehicle that has been driven hard most likely from the previous owner.

Also gas will not be your friend.

Not saying don't buy, I just wouldn't daily it.

Is snap-on tools just a meme or are they're pricess warranted as opposed to craftsmen and husky/HF shit.

This goes for everything,

Hand tools
Electric cordless
Tool chests and miscellaneous
29 posts and 5 images submitted.
>>
>>16738176
>This goes for everything,
But it doesn't, it depends on the tool, what you are using it for, and why. In my case some tools I will only by from Snap On, and others I am fine with Harbor Freight. If I worked on heavy diesels or trains there would be different tools that I needed to hold up forever and others I could use cheap shit. You'll figure it out when you need to, if you have to wonder if it's worth it you probably don't need to spend that much on a tool.
>>
File: IMG_0371.jpg (584KB, 1920x1080px) Image search: [Google]
IMG_0371.jpg
584KB, 1920x1080px
Poorfags complain about not being able to afford real tools, go get a Stanley set from Walmart
>>
>>16738176
It depends on many different factors. Their 80 tooth ratchet is wonderful and worth every penny, but their boxes are just overkill for a DIY person.

They have a really nice cordless ratchet if you are a pro, but other than that I would steer clear of their cordless tools. You're better off with a brand like milwaukee or dewalt.
